Intuitive Machines vs. Vertiv: Which Industrials Stock Is a Better Buy in 2026?

Vertiv is presented as the stronger 2026 risk-reward investment, supported by FY2025 revenue growth of 28% to $10.2B, $1.3B of net income, and $1.9B of free cash flow; 2026 revenue is projected to rise another 36% to $13.9B on AI data-center demand. Intuitive Machines generated FY2025 revenue of about $210M, down 8%, and an $83.3M net loss with negative $56M free cash flow, although it reported a record $187M opening FY2026 quarter and holds a $1.1B backlog. The article favors Vertiv due to its more predictable AI-infrastructure market, profitability, and substantially lower 26.5x forward P/E versus Intuitive Machines' 3,333x.

Analysis

VRT is a higher-quality way to express AI capex than NVDA because its revenue is tied to the physical deployment phase rather than chip procurement alone. The key earnings sensitivity is mix: liquid-cooling and integrated power systems should carry higher content-per-megawatt and service attach rates, supporting margins even if unit growth normalizes. ETN and Schneider Electric are the more relevant competitive hedges; ETN’s electrical exposure benefits from the same grid-constrained data-center buildout, while VRT retains greater upside if rack densities keep rising.

The principal near-term risk is not a collapse in AI demand but a digestion period after hyperscalers pre-order capacity. A reduction in backlog conversion, book-to-bill below 1.0x, or weaker cloud-provider capex guidance would compress VRT’s premium before reported revenue weakens, likely over the next 1-3 months. Over 6-18 months, utility interconnection delays and power availability may shift spend from conventional data centers toward on-site generation, storage, and power-management vendors, favoring ETN more than pure thermal suppliers.

LUNR should be treated as a venture-style government-contract optionality position, not a comparable industrial compounder. The market is likely to capitalize announced awards and backlog too aggressively relative to contract funding, milestone timing, cost-to-complete, and dilution requirements. Its upside can be discontinuous on successful mission execution, but one technical failure, procurement delay, or adverse working-capital revision could force a large equity-risk repricing; the appropriate catalyst window is mission and award-specific rather than quarterly.

Contrarian view: VRT’s apparent valuation advantage can be misleading if consensus is embedding peak AI infrastructure margins. The better relative trade is not outright bearishness, but owning VRT against a more diversified electrical-infrastructure hedge: cooling demand is real, yet power distribution, grid equipment, and service revenue may prove more durable once AI buildouts move from greenfield construction to utilization optimization.
